drm/udl: Replace semaphore with a simple wait queue
UDL driver uses a semaphore for controlling the emptiness of FIFO in a slightly funky way. This patch replaces it with a wait queue and controls the emptiness with the standard wait_event*() macro instead, which is a more straightforward implementation. While we are at it, drop the dead code for delayed semaphore down, too.
